2012-07-05 61 views
2

我們正在爲所有外部服務器構建一個狀態欄。我們數據庫中的每個條目都有對操作系統,軟件版本等的引用。這些值是不斷變化的,我們希望在我們的數據庫中更新特定div的更改。我們已經編寫了一個輪詢機制來檢查每20分鐘的更改並立即在數據庫中更新條目。但是,如果我們刷新頁面,我們只能看到它們。使用Rails定期輪詢數據庫查看無刷新更新

是否rails具有內置的機制,可以讓我們定期檢查數據庫並根據新更改更新視圖而無需刷新頁面?我應該使用JQuery AJAX命令嗎?如果是這樣,我將如何實現這一點?

我們將Rails 3.2.1,Ruby 1.9.2與jquery和twitter-bootstrap結合使用。

任何幫助,將不勝感激。

+0

您是否設法找到解決此問題的方法? – DazBaldwin 2013-06-12 20:21:00

回答

1

我知道這是一個遲到的回覆,但我偶然發現它,並認爲它應該有一個答案。

你可以嘗試this railscast,因爲它使用Ajax輪詢數據庫中的變化,並動態更新視圖

我個人尋找替代這種方法,但它可能是任何人誰發現它有用